1. Choose the Right Time to Visit Kerala
Kerala is a destination anytime because it is a tropical state, but each three months are different from each other.
- Winter (October to February): Best time to travel in and around Kerala, best sightseeing, houseboat holiday, beach holiday.
- Monsoon (June to September): Best time to unwind in an Ayurveda resort and the greens of Kerala in their best lush green.
- Summer (March to May): Usually the most ideal time to trek all the way up to hill stations such as Munnar and Wayanad in order to avoid the heat.
2. Plan Your Itinerary Wisely
There's more or less everybody and anybody who comes to mind in Kerala, so the most one can do is pack one's diary to the full to capacity with lots of everything and anything else so that you won't have room to monkey around with anything.
- Backwaters: Alleppey and Kumarakom are world-renowned for houseboat cruises and serene canals.
- Beaches: Kovalam, Varkala, or Marari is where you need to relax.
- Hill Stations: Nature lovers would find Munnar tea plantations and waterfalls in Wayanad interesting.
- Cultural Heritage: Kochi colonial history, temple structure in Thrissur, and Kathakali and Theyyam dance.
- Wildlife & Nature: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ary at walking distance of Thekkady and Silent Valley National Park are ecotourism sites.

3. Select off-the-eye places of Smart Modes of Transport
Traveling within Kerala will be easy with good travel planning.
- By Air: Kochi, Thiruvananthapuram, and Calicut all have three international airports.
- By Train: Kerala is properly connected by train with most of the respective town and cities.

5. Local Flavors
Live your Kerala sojourn with local culture and tradition activities.
Consume local Kerala cuisine — from crispy fried appams and puttu to tongue-licking fish curry.
Participate in Onam, Thrissur Pooram, or Nehru Trophy Boat Race celebrations.
Take a spice plantation, tea plantation, and farm bazaar tour.
Relax and pamper yourself with an Ayurvedic massage or treatment session to feel fresh to the core.

6. Pack Sensibly for the Trip
Kerala climate is differential location wise. Light cotton cloth clothes to wear to beaches and plains and winter wear if going to hill stations. Sun cream, insect spray, and shoes can't be left behind.
